What Ger PNP transistors do I use for the following circuit in a
radio: HF AMPLIFIER, MIXER; LF AMOPLIFIER, DRIVER and AUDIO OUTPUT?
You don't.

Germanium transistors were pretty much obsoleted forty years ago, by
silicon transistors. There is a far better range of silicon transistors,
and generally they have far better specs than germanium transistors.

The only reason you'd use a germanium transistor at this time is if
there was a specific reason for using germanium. There are still some
things where germanium transistors can be useful, which is why some
are still being manufactured, but the average hobbyist wouldn't have
need for those uses. And there is no reason to use germanium transistors
in a radio.

If you are looking for germanium tranistors because you have a schematic
that uses them, and then you can't find the devices specified, it's because
the schematic is decades old and you need to drop that schematic and
find soemthing more modern, than try to find germanium transistors
to use in the schematic.

The reason some of us have germanium transistors lying around is because
we accumualted them decades ago, when they were still common. Beyond
taht, you'll have to go out of your way to get them.

Hi, Daniel. I've got to assume you're working with an existing radio
circuit, probably an older one made in the 1960s when germanium PNPs
and negative supplies (positive GND) ruled the earth. Those were the
days.

Here's the drill. Find the standard JEDEC 2N number, either in the
schematic or printed on the body/case of the transistor. Then go to
this link:

http://nte01.nteinc.com/nte/NTExRefSemiProd.nsf/$$Search?OpenForm

and type in the manufacturer part number for the transistor. The NTE
cross reference will probably work for you. NTE parts are available
at many different places, including many TV/radio repair shops. You
can also get these online at many places. You can go to their main
page:

http://nteinc.com/

to find a distributor.

Hi, Dan. I like the idea of working from the diary to discover what
your uncle was thinking. But there are a couple of gotchas here.

First off, many ideas jotted down in notebooks aren't really
complete. I know many of mine aren't. He may have been just writing
in an idea to fill out later.

Also, an old AM radio design with less than 5 transistors is probably
taking a shortcut somewhere. Not necessarily a bad thing, but even if
it's a guaranteed working circuit he just copied down, it's probably
relying on a trick we'd have to see to evaluate choice of
transistors. I'd hate to see you and the kids go to the work of
trying to put something together from scratch and have it fail because
of some free newsgroup advice. ;-)

As a bonus, layout in RF circuits is pretty important, to prevent
unwanted oscillations in the amplifier stages. Working from a
schematic only, as a relative newbie you might end up going down a
rabbit trail there, too.

Old educational transistor radio kits are still being made which are
guaranteed to work and provide a good educational experience. You
could do worse than getting the Elenco AM-550TK (5 transistor, no ICs,
old-style transistor radio kit with good educational brochure
explaining the circuit), building it with the kids, and then raising a
glass to the memory of their dad's uncle when they turn it on and it
works. Similar in many ways, you get all the parts you need, almost
guaranteed success if you have any soldering and assembly skill, and
after you're done, you'll understand a lot more about his idea (and
possibly where the shortcut is).
